Abstract
A method for controlling the foam produced when a molten material encounters reduced pressure in a vacuum chamber includes passing the molten material through an aging zone in the vacuum chamber in which the molten material is allowed to drain from between the bubbles of the foam and then collapsing the bubbles of the drained foam.

12. A reduced pressure finer, comprising:
-
a finer chamber having a pressure below atmospheric pressure;
a first conduit for conducting molten material to the finer chamber, the first conduit being inclined to the vertical, wherein the bubbles in the molten material collect at a surface of the first conduit as the molten material flows through the first conduit; and
a second conduit for removing the molten material from the finer chamber. - View Dependent Claims (13, 14)
